there are a few reasons why it wasn't implemented..i think one of them was how to present such logic in a manageable way. right now we have 9 combinations(upload/download/fxp - smaller/same/larger) with 3 or 4 choices in each. now image how complicated that will become if you'll add logic for date/time for older/same/newer...that will be a total of 81-108 combinations.
if you can think of a way to present such logic to a user, feel free to share